Diesel Truck Maintenance Technician

Certificate

This fully-loaded program develops the skills necessary to repair, inspect, and maintain diesel-powered highway equipment.

Learn about diesel truck preventative maintenance and service, and the theory and skills needed to perform vehicle inspection and engine tune-up. You'll become skilled in overhauling engines, transmissions, and rear differentials, as well as repairing air-brakes, chassis and suspensions.

Earn your certificate in just 10 months full-time, or two-years part-time. And when you graduate you'll be ready to take the Pennsylvania Vehicle Safety Inspection examinations.

Graduates of this program interested in more advanced training can continue on in the Diesel Technology Associate of Applied Science degree with just an additional year of study.

Careers

Entry-level heavy-duty commercial truck preventative maintenance technician for:

  • Dealerships
  • Independent garages
  • Truck fleets
  • Leasing companies

Facilities: Modern Fully-Equipped Labs

Gain hands-on experience in advanced learning labs where you’ll work on equipment just like you can expect to see after graduation.  

While you're here, you'll have an opportunity to earn certifications in: 

  • Stationary Refrigeration (608)
  • Motor Vehicle Air-Conditioning (609)
  • Allison Transmission Certification
  • Level 1 Eaton Hybrid Certification

Acceptance into this major is offered for the Fall semester only. This major has limited seat capacity. Acceptance is offered on a rolling basis until the seat capacity has been met. Students must accept their seat in the major by confirming their intent to enroll.

Students must acquire their own tools and laptop computer as noted below.

Required Tools, Uniforms, and Supplies

See the Tool List for this major.

Required Laptop Computer

  • Chromebooks and other devices running Chrome OS are prohibited.
  • Unless otherwise specified by your major, MacBooks and other Apple products are not recommended for coursework.
  • Windows 11 or higher (recommended).
  • Intel Core i5 or i7 or AMD Ryzen 5 or 7 processor (recommended).
  • ARM based processors are not recommended.
  • 16+ GB RAM (recommended).
  • 250+ GB Solid State Disk (SSD) drive (recommended).
  • Laptop must include a webcam and microphone (required).
  • Laptop must include a wireless network card (required).
  • Broadband Internet connection when working off campus (required).
  • Extended support agreement, including accidental damage protection (recommended).
  • Power bank suitable for your laptop (recommended).
